Sometimes, it’s best to keep it simple. Always, it’s best to listen to Grandma. This classic homemade biscuit recipe on its gluten free version are not only very easy to make but quick too. With only a few ingredients you can have hot delicious biscuits in less than an hour from beginning to end. In this recipe we add vanilla and lemon zest for flavour, but we recommend you experiment! Try chocolate chips, different spices, diced fruits – or even top with icing. Go on, make Grandma proud!

Temperature
200 °C
- Sieve the flour into a bowl, make a well in the middle and add the sugar, eggs, butter, salt, flavours and grated lemon zest.
- Mix everything together thoroughly. Then cover with a cloth and chill in the refrigerator for 1 hour.
- Preheat the oven to 200 °C. Grease a baking tray with oil and dust with flour.
- Dust the work surface with flour. Roll out the dough with a rolling pin and cut out your preferred biscuit shapes.
- Distribute the biscuits on the baking tray with plenty of space between each and bake on the middle shelf of the oven for approx. 15 minutes.
